EHOLD, O Lord, I come unto thee, that I may be comforted in thy gift, and be dehghted in thy holy banquet, which thou, O God, hast of thy goodness prepared for the poor.^ I>ehold in thee is all whatsoever I can or ought to desire; and thou art my salvation and my redemption, my hope and my strength, my honour and glory. Make therefore this day the soul of thy servantjoyful;- for unto thee, O Lord Jesu, have I liftedup my soul. I desire to receive thee now with devotion andreverence. I desire to bring thee into my house, * Psalm lx\ iii. lo. - Psalin Ixxxvi. 4. I MIT ATI ox OF CHRIST. 353 that with Zaccheus I may be blessed by thee, andbe numbered amongst the children of Abraham. My soul thirsteth to receive thy body andblood, my heart longeth to be joined to thee. 2. Give thyself to me, and it sufficeth; forbeside thee there is no comfort.
